Non-woven fibers are versatile materials made from interlocking fibers that are bonded together through mechanical, thermal, or chemical processes. Unlike traditional woven fabrics, non-woven fibers do not require weaving or knitting, making them a cost-effective and efficient option for various applications. These materials can be produced in different weights, thicknesses, and compositions, allowing for customization based on specific requirements.
Non-woven fibers are used across a broad spectrum of industries, including healthcare, automotive, construction, and textiles. In the healthcare sector, they are popular for products like surgical gowns and masks due to their barrier properties and breathability. In automotive manufacturing, non-woven materials serve as soundproofing and insulation. The construction industry utilizes non-woven fibers for geotextiles and insulation, highlighting their adaptability and utility.
As the demand for sustainable and eco-friendly materials increases, the market for non-woven fibers continues to grow. They are often viewed as a more environmentally friendly option compared to traditional textiles, as they can be made from recycled materials and often have a lower carbon footprint during production.

๐๐ผ๐บ๐บ๐ผ๐ป ๐๐ฝ๐ฝ๐น๐ถ๐ฐ๐ฎ๐๐ถ๐ผ๐ป๐ ๐ฎ๐ป๐ฑ ๐จ๐๐ฒ ๐๐ฎ๐๐ฒ๐
Non-woven fibers are utilized in a wide array of industries due to their unique properties and versatility.
1. Healthcare: Non-woven fibers are essential in the production of surgical masks, gowns, and drapes, providing barriers against contaminants while allowing breathability.
2. Automotive: In the automotive sector, non-woven materials are used for sound insulation, interior linings, and filters, contributing to overall vehicle comfort and performance.
3. Construction: Non-woven fibers are commonly employed in geotextiles, which help with soil stabilization and erosion control. They are also used in insulation materials for improved energy efficiency.
4. Household Products: Non-woven fabrics are found in cleaning wipes, disposable dusters, and absorbent pads, offering convenience and functionality.
5. Agriculture: These fibers serve as crop covers and mulch mats, helping to regulate soil temperature and moisture.
6. Fashion and Textiles: Non-woven materials are used in fashion items, bags, and other textiles, providing lightweight and durable options.
7. Filtration: Non-woven fibers are employed in air and liquid filtration systems, enhancing the efficiency of filtering processes.
๐ฃ๐ฟ๐ผ๐ฑ๐๐ฐ๐ ๐ฉ๐ฎ๐ฟ๐ถ๐ฎ๐ป๐๐ ๐ฎ๐ป๐ฑ ๐ฆ๐๐ฏ๐ฐ๐ฎ๐๐ฒ๐ด๐ผ๐ฟ๐ถ๐ฒ๐
Non-woven fibers offer a range of variants to suit different industrial needs.
Polypropylene Non-Woven Fibers
These fibers are lightweight and moisture-resistant, making them ideal for disposable medical products and hygiene items. They provide an excellent balance of strength and softness.
Polyester Non-Woven Fibers
Known for their durability and resistance to wear, polyester non-woven fibers are commonly used in automotive applications and durable goods, providing both functionality and aesthetic appeal.
Biodegradable Non-Woven Fibers
These eco-friendly options are made from natural materials that decompose over time, making them suitable for applications in agriculture and environmentally conscious products.
Meltblown Non-Woven Fibers
This variant is known for its fine filtration properties, making it ideal for use in medical masks and air filters, where high levels of filtration efficiency are required.
Spunbond Non-Woven Fibers
Spunbond fibers are robust and versatile, commonly used in durable applications like landscaping and construction, offering strength and longevity.
